编程已成为当今社会不可或缺的一部分。在我国,编程教育也逐渐受到重视,众多高校纷纷开设相关课程,培养编程人才。大学讲师在教授编程课程时,不仅需要具备扎实的专业素养,更要关注代码的艺术性,将编程与教育完美融合。本文将从大学讲师代码的视角,探讨编程与教育的交融之美。

一、大学讲师代码的内涵

大学讲师代码的艺术探索编程与教育的交融之美  第1张

1. 严谨性

大学讲师的代码应具备严谨性,遵循编程规范,确保程序的正确性。这既是教授学生的基本要求,也是提高自身教学水平的体现。严谨的代码有助于学生养成良好的编程习惯,为今后的职业生涯奠定坚实基础。

2. 可读性

代码的可读性是大学讲师代码的重要特征。清晰的注释、合理的命名、合理的代码结构,使代码易于理解和维护。大学讲师应注重代码的可读性,以便学生更好地学习编程。

3. 创新性

大学讲师的代码应具有一定的创新性,激发学生的创新思维。通过引入新颖的算法、设计独特的程序,使学生在学习过程中感受到编程的魅力,激发他们对编程的兴趣。

4. 实用性

大学讲师的代码应具有实用性,紧密结合实际应用场景。通过实际案例教学,让学生了解编程在各个领域的应用,提高他们的实践能力。

二、编程与教育的交融之美

1. 编程培养创新思维

编程是一门实践性很强的学科,它要求学生在解决问题的过程中不断思考、创新。大学讲师在教授编程课程时,通过引导学生分析问题、设计算法、编写代码,培养他们的创新思维。这种思维在学生今后的职业生涯中具有重要意义。

2. 编程促进团队合作

编程往往需要团队合作完成,大学讲师在教授编程课程时,注重培养学生的团队协作能力。通过小组讨论、共同解决问题,让学生学会与他人沟通、协作,为今后步入职场打下基础。

3. 编程提高解决问题的能力

编程课程强调问题导向,大学讲师通过引导学生分析问题、设计算法、编写代码,提高他们解决问题的能力。这种能力在学生今后的学习和工作中具有极高的价值。

4. 编程培养自主学习能力

编程学习需要学生具备自主学习能力,大学讲师在教授编程课程时,鼓励学生主动探索、深入研究。这种自主学习能力有助于学生终身学习,不断提高自身素质。

三、大学讲师代码在编程教育中的应用

1. 案例教学

大学讲师可以通过实际案例教学,让学生了解编程在各个领域的应用。通过分析案例代码,使学生掌握编程技巧,提高编程能力。

2. 项目实践

大学讲师可以引导学生参与项目实践,通过实际编程任务,让学生将所学知识应用于实际,提高他们的实践能力。

3. 编程竞赛

大学讲师可以组织学生参加编程竞赛,激发他们的学习兴趣,提高编程水平。在竞赛过程中,学生将学会与他人竞争、合作,培养团队精神。

4. 代码分享与交流

大学讲师可以鼓励学生分享自己的代码,进行交流学习。通过互相借鉴、改进,提高学生的编程能力。

总结

大学讲师代码的艺术性是编程与教育交融的重要体现。在教授编程课程时,大学讲师应注重代码的严谨性、可读性、创新性和实用性,培养学生的创新思维、团队合作能力、解决问题能力和自主学习能力。通过案例教学、项目实践、编程竞赛和代码分享与交流等方式,使编程与教育完美融合,为我国培养更多优秀的编程人才。